The STMicroelectronics UC3842BD1 is a high-performance current-mode PWM controller designed for off-line switching power supplies. This versatile controller supports both boost and flyback topologies, featuring an isolation-capable positive output. With a wide operating voltage range of 10V to 30V and a maximum duty cycle of 96%, the UC3842BD1 is suitable for demanding applications. It offers precise frequency control, with switching frequencies up to 500kHz, enabling compact and efficient power designs. The device operates within a temperature range of 0°C to 70°C (TA) and is housed in an 8-SOIC (0.154", 3.90mm Width) package for surface mounting. Industries utilizing this component include industrial automation, consumer electronics, and telecommunications.
